And some basics about filling in your brows is that you do not want chose too dark of the color. My hair is dyed, it is kind of like a brownish so I chose a brownish color. I would not do black because that will not make your eyebrows look filled in a little bit. It is too harsh.
And generally, you want to do like some browns or a dark brown, on that way, you can kind of pick a more natural color. And what I want to do first is use this little disposable mascara one and brush the hair in place.

Can you see that? So basically, you want your brow to extend at a diagonal angle with your eye. So my eyebrow is too short. See how it is about a centimeter off. It should be like right here, same thing with this eye. It should be like around right here. So it does not have to be perfect but I am pretty much going to take my eyebrow pencil and make look little feathers strokes and draw in the rest of the tip. It should be a little bit thinner because that is how eyebrows are, they are not stick the whole way through. I just draw it in with a little feather strokes.
